1. Introduction This watercolor painting depicts plants on a sunlit window sill. A large plant with variegated leaves dominates the right side, while a smaller pot sits to the left. The boundary between interior and exterior is rendered with soft light. The composition captures a quiet moment, emphasizing the beauty of natural light. 2. Description The prominent plant features heart-shaped leaves with yellow and white patterns. The smaller terracotta pot holds a plant with delicate foliage. Outside, bright green suggests background trees. The light enters diagonally from the upper left, casting soft patches on the wall and leaves. 3. Analysis The work utilizes the transparent qualities of watercolor wash. Blue and violet tones in the shadows contrast with the green and yellow palette, adding depth. The diagonal pattern of light spots creates rhythm. The contrast between different plants establishes visual variety. 4. Interpretation and Evaluation The artwork represents the transient beauty of light and indoor tranquility. The descriptive skill in capturing the luminous effects is exceptional. By utilizing a window scene, the work presents the harmony between nature and home. The overall depiction evokes a serene feeling. 5. Conclusion In conclusion, this painting highlights the fluid charm of watercolor. While it initially appears simple, the meticulous placement of light patches reveals a deeper sense of space. It successfully elevates a mundane sight into an artistic experience. The dialogue between light and nature is beautiful.
